The first time Andrew cried, it was from anger. Fat, angry tears because the Foxes had lost the championship. It was because of him and Andrew knew it.
The second time Andrew cried, it was from sadness. David Wymack had died of a heart attack. The tears were heavy and his breath was ragged as he stared at the coffin. That man saved his life and Andrew knew it.
The third time Andrew cried, it was from happiness. Renee had agreed to be a surrogate for himself and Neil. At the hospital, looking at the child in his arms with his husband's eyes, the tears rolled past a smile. He’d cry more now and Andrew knew it.
